Collection of a large number of alchemical and medicinal preparations, some with the names of famous men attached, e.g., Glauber (f. 2v, 78v), Paracelsus (f. 9v), Matthiolus (f. 17r), Fernel (f. 23v), Galen (f. 26v), Mynsicht (f. 30v), Hippocrates (f. 46v), Sydenham (f. 79r). Alphabetical index to preparations on f. 122-140. Many of the recipes stem from an "officina Mülhausiana" (f. 27v, today Mulhouse), see the initial "M" and the note "Mülh" throughout. Others are marked "G" or "Gen," probably for Genève.

University of Pennsylvania digitized manuscript 140 leaves : paper, illustrations ; 202 x 161 mm bound to 207 x 167 mm; Binding: Contemporary boards.; Dates in text: 1720 (f. 81r), 1719 (f. 81v), and "paratum mense Aprili 1722 Genev" (f. 82r). A printed dealer's description pasted inside upper cover gives date 1784, but the description does not fit the contents of this volume.; Decoration: Pen-and-ink illustrations of distallation apparatus "distillatio chymica de cornu cervi" (f. 19r), "distillato chymica de viperis" (f. 48v) and "rectificatio" (f. 50v).; Foliation: Paper, 140; 1-53, 56-86, [87-142]; contemporary or near-contemporary foliation in ink, modern foliation in pencil, upper right recto. Text continues on f. 119-113 upside down and in reverse order; f. 87-112, 141-142 blank.; French and Latin.; Ms. codex.; Origin: Written in Mulhouse or Geneva after 1722.; Script: Written in various cursive scripts by several hands.; Title supplied by cataloger (Rudolf Hirsch notes on file in Library). | 1722 | — | French, Latin | — | Public download |
